Behavior
Behavior refers to the actions or reactions of an organism, usually in relation to its environment, which can be observable or measurable.
Milgram's Obedience Experiment
A psychological experiment conducted by Stanley Milgram which measured the willingness of participants to obey an authority figure who instructed them to perform acts conflicting with their personal conscience.
Ethical Dilemmas
Situations where there is a conflict between moral imperatives, making it challenging to decide the right course of action.
Components Of Attitude
The aspects that make up attitudes, typically including cognitive (beliefs), affective (feelings), and behavioral (actions) components.
